Mtec discs on my starlet super braking power. Would recommend to stay away from any drilled discs on a road car as if you’ve heat in the brakes and hit a puddle they will crack. Happened my mtec discs (had sticky calliper, hit a puddle). Mtec did however replace the discs, sent out a new set after I set pictures to them.
